About Huntingdon County Prison

Huntingdon County Prison PA was completed in 1999. Huntingdon County Prison is a detention facility with 654 inmates. The Huntingdon County Prison is located in the 300 Church Street, Huntingdon, PA, 16652, and run by the Huntingdon County county Sherriff Department.

The Huntingdon County Prison, Pennsylvania is managed daily with a staff of around 199 personnel, including dispatchers, deputies, administrators, clerks, etc.

It is regarded as a therapeutic jail where Huntingdon County inmates are afforded several opportunities to help them with skill, health, and education. Inmates can get GED classes, computer lessons, and financial management lessons. Additionally, the Huntingdon County Prison offers substance abuse programs, which help treat and counsel inmates. Huntingdon County Prison has the capability of housing both petty offenders and high-risk violent inmates.

Visitation at Huntingdon County Prison

Inmates will need to provide a list of people permitted to visit them. This can be changed twice every month.

Visits are only thirty minutes, starting at the top of the hour and half-hour all week through.

As of March 2020, the Huntingdon County Prison closed down visitation to curb the spread of Covid19 virus.

Normally, visits are allowed at the Huntingdon County Prison Monday through Sunday.

It will be advisable for visitors to call the Huntingdon County Prison before making the trip to ensure they are familiar with any visiting rules.

Also, they must dress conservatively and carry a valid ID.
